The Nature of the Legal Challenge to the Dial 108 Ambulance Contract

The legal challenge to the Dial 108 ambulance service contract stemmed from concerns raised by various petitioners. These concerns primarily revolved around the transparency of the bidding process, the specific terms of the contract itself, and perceived irregularities in the awarding of the contract to the current service provider. The petitioners argued that the process lacked sufficient transparency, potentially leading to unfair competition and ultimately impacting the quality of the ambulance service provided to the citizens of Maharashtra.

  • Arguments raised by petitioners included:
    • Allegations of favoritism in the selection of the service provider.
    • Concerns regarding the lack of public consultation during the bidding process.
    • Questions about the long-term viability and cost-effectiveness of the contract terms.
    • Claims that the contract failed to adequately address service quality standards.

These concerns, focusing on the Dial 108 Ambulance Service and the legal framework surrounding its contract, highlighted the complexities involved in managing large-scale public-private partnerships for essential services. The case became a significant test of the legal robustness of the contract and the transparency of the government's procurement processes. The Bombay High Court's Ruling and its Rationale

The Bombay High Court, after careful consideration of the arguments presented by both sides, dismissed the legal challenge against the Dial 108 Ambulance Contract. The court found that the petitioners failed to provide sufficient evidence to support their claims of irregularities. The judgment emphasized the importance of upholding contracts awarded through established procedures, recognizing the crucial role of the Dial 108 service in providing emergency medical care.

  • Key aspects of the Bombay HC Judgment included:
    • Validation of the bidding process used to award the Dial 108 contract.
    • Rejection of allegations of favoritism and lack of transparency.
    • Affirmation of the contract's legal soundness and adherence to relevant regulations.
    • Emphasis on the critical role of the Dial 108 service in providing timely emergency medical response.
